Would like an answer for this question. Which represents 7(45) using the distributive property to simplify? SELECT THE TWO THAT

APPLY. 1# 7 (40 - 5) 2# 7 (4) + 7 (5) 3# 7 (40 +5) 4# 7 (40) + 7(5)

Answer:

7(45)=7(40)+7(5)

Step-by-step explanation:

We need to represent 7(45) using the distributive property to simplify.

We can write 45 as 40+5

So it becomes,

7(45) = 7(40+5)

Distributive property is : a(b+c)=ab+ac

a=7, b = 40 and c = 5

7(40+5)=7(40)+7(5)

So, the correct option is (4).

An individual is planning a trip to a baseball game for 16 people. Of the people planning to go to the baseball game, 8 can go o
Sedaia [141]

Answer: There are 4 people who only go to the game on Saturday.

Step-by-step explanation:

Let the number of people go on Saturday be n(A).

Let the number of people go on Sunday be n(B).

Since we have given that

n(A) = 8

n(B) = 12

n(A∪B)  = 16

According to rules, we get that

n(A)+n(B)-n(A\cap B)=n(A\cup B)\\\\8+12-n(A\cap B)=16\\\\20-n(A\cap B)=16\\\\n(A\cap B)=20-16=4

So, n(only go on Saturday) = n(only A) = n(A) - n(A∩B) = 8-4 = 4

Hence, there are 4 people who only go to the game on Saturday.
